1- The Apocalyptic Pillar

On the western facade of the building, stonemasons have sculpted numerous scenes that seem oddly out of place for a Cathedral. The most striking one is the chilling depiction of the destruction of New York City and its landmarks.

pillar1

Twin towers collapsing

The scene above was done in 1997, four years before the destruction of the Twin Towers.  Other recognizable skyscrapers are the Chrysler Building and the Citigroup Center.

bottompillar

Apocalyptic New York

The scene above might be unsettling for New York residents. We see the Brooklyn bridge crumbling with cars and buses falling into agitated waters. At the right is the Statue of Liberty, which seems to be sinking in the water. Beneath this horrifying prophecy is the New York Stock Exchange, with people trading goods around it.

nystockxchangenystockxchang2

Strange Rituals

A) Procession of the Ghouls

Every year, at Halloween, St. John the Divine is the host of a strange event called “The Grand Procession of the Ghouls”. It is basically a parade taking place right inside the sanctuary of the Cathedral where people dressed in costumes of demons, ghouls, monsters and other creepy things, walk around to macabre organ music. This thing resembles the strange rituals held behind closed doors by occult groups. Outside of the great number of costumes representing demons and Satan (already extremely bizarre for a Cathedral), some costumes seem to make a mockery out of Christianity.

D) Paul Winter’s Winter Solstice Celebration

paul_winterrosewindow

Can’t worship the Sun more than that

This famous New Age musician celebrates the Winter solstice, one of the most ancient pagan rituals. He says on his website about the consort:

In ancient times, observers watched the sun sink lower in the sky each day, and feared it would disappear completely and leave them in darkness.

People practiced special rituals intended to entice the sun’s return. Bonfires and candles, with their imitative magic, helped fortify the waning sun and ward off the spirits of darkness. These symbols live on in our modern seasonal customs: the candles of Hanukkah and Christmas are kin to the fiery rites of old, which celebrated the miracle of the earth’s renewal.
